Abstract
OFDM is a practical and efficient modulation technology. Frequency synchronization for OFDM is very important because the carrier frequency offset (CFO) will damage the performance. Based on the correlation between the front half-symbol and the back half-symbol, a cost function is deduced which varies with the carrier frequency offset as a sine function, and then a new carrier frequency offset estimation algorithm is presented.
